Bonsoir à tous,
j'ai 2 petites questions, j'ai décidé de me remettre à Asterisk après quelques années et tester PJSIP, malheureusement j'ai quelques petits soucis.

Je suis connectée à plusieurs serveur Free, OVH.... mais je n'arrive pas à récupérer le numéro appelé lors des appels entrants,
mes appels arrivent forcément dans l'extension "s".
Donc j'arrive à résoudre le problème, d'une multitude de façons, en essayant de récupérer le Header "To" qui contient mon numéro, ou en essayant de récupérer le nom du channel qui contient le nom du Trunk qui a reçu l'appel. Mais je me demandais s'il n'y avait pas un moyen plus simple.


fichier extension.conf

[call_in]
exten => s,1,NoOp(${PJSIP_HEADER(read,To)})
exten => s,n,Goto(${CHANNEL:6:3},go)
exten => fre,n(go),Goto(maison,331xxxxxxxx1,1)
exten => ovh,n(go),Goto(maison,331xxxxxxxx2,1)


Il me semble qu'avec le SIP, c'était plus simple :
register => user[:secret[:authuser]]@host[:port][/extension]

Il suffisait de configurer le numéro souhaité à la fin de la commande register, mais je ne vois pas l'équivalent avec PJSIP.